Getting Your Garden Ready for the Season Ahead
Fall weather signals a shift in gardening practices, and landscapes need attention to prepare for the season ahead. Gardeners should begin this work about six weeks before the first hard freeze, adjusting watering strategies to help plants transition into winter and reviewing what to prune in late fall before growth slows for the year.
